Warning Signs You Need AC Unit Water Removal

Catching the signs of AC unit water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to call our team.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ains can be a sign of hidden moisture behind your walls and ceilings.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to call our team right away.

Increased Energy Bills

AC units that are malfunctioning can cause your energy bills to skyrocket. If you notice a sudden increase in your energy bills, it may be a sign of a problem with your AC unit.

AC Unit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ak from AC unit Yes No You can likely fix the issue yourself with a DIY repair kit.
Water damage from AC unit in multiple rooms No Yes Professional help is needed to contain and dry out the affected area.
Visible mold growth around AC unit No Yes Mold growth needs professional remediation to ensure your home is safe and healthy.
AC unit is malfunctioning and causing water damage No Yes A professional AC technician is needed to diagnose and repair the issue.
Water damage from AC unit in a rental property No Yes Professional help is needed to ensure the issue is resolved and the property is safe for tenants.
Water damage from AC unit in a historic home No Yes Professional help is needed to preserve the historic integrity of the home and ensure the damage is resolved correctly.

How can I prevent AC unit water damage in the future?

Regular maintenance is key. Make sure to inspect your AC unit regularly and replace the drain pan and condensate lines as needed. You should also consider installing a condensate pump or drain to help prevent water damage.
